How do I get a TRICARE disenrollment letter?
You can disenroll from TRICARE Prime via:
- Web: Log into the Beneficiary Web Enrollment Portal.
- Phone: Call your regional contractor. East: 1-800-444-5445. West:1-844-866-9378. Overseas: Call the Regional Call Center for your overseas area.
- Mail: Download your region’s disenrollment form: East Disenrollment Form.

How do you lose TRICARE benefits?
Reasons You May Lose Eligibility
- Sponsor Separates from Active Duty.
- You Have Medicare Part A, but don’t Purchase Part B.
- Dependent Child Reaches Age Limit.
- Divorce.
- Surviving Spouse, Widow, or Former Spouse Remarries.
- DEERS Information Not Kept Up-to-Date.
Can you still get TRICARE after the military?
You have 90 days from your separation date to change your TRICARE health plan. Separating from the military means that you leave the service before you retire. You and your family may qualify for temporary health care coverage when you separate from the service.

Can I continue TRICARE after discharge?
Leaving active duty is a TRICARE Qualifying Life Event (QLE). During this time, you have 90 days from your separation date to change to another health plan if you’re eligible. Depending on the reason for your separation, you may be able to get other health coverage that’s associated with TRICARE.

Can I remove my spouse from TRICARE?
Divorce, annulment, or dissolution of a marriage is a TRICARE Qualifying Life Event (QLE). This QLE allows you and family members to make changes to your TRICARE Prime or TRICARE Select health plan outside of TRICARE Open Season.
